The calculation of the value for summer heat protection includes the total solar energy transmittance gtot for the combination of sun shading system and glazing or the shading factor FC.

The FC value is calculated from the ratio of the total solar energy transmittance of the sun shading system and glazing combination and the g value of the glazing: FC = gtot/g. The calculation of the FC value therefore also always takes the glazing into consideration – for this reason no fixed FC value can be given for a sun shading product. Here you will find light transmission- τv, light reflection- ρv and light absorption coefficients αv, as well as values for radiation transmission- τe, solar reflection- ρe and solar absorptance αe for various sun shading products. In addition, the general colour rendering index Ra is available.
